Transaction db177c90900a24c0da843eab1e03747af23b5bb7c9138620d4f65523c4993968
1 Input
1 Output
-
db177c90900a24c0da843eab1e03747af23b5bb7c9138620d4f65523c4993968:0
- value
- 357804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e350d17e4a4dee6d73290cb698db03d150f32247 OP_EQUAL
- address
- 3NQx8SnuycnWJzv97myMKzF6Jjce3PveRA